About this game

Archon II: Adept is a strategy and tactical board game that expands on the original Archon with a more complex, shifting battlefield and enhanced gameplay. Two sides—Chaos and Order—are represented by powerful Adepts who battle through spellcasting and summoned creatures.

Each side can summon four unique Elementals, while four Demons are available to both sides. Encounters between Adepts can shift into direct arcade-style combat, adding action to the chess-like strategic play. The changing board makes each battle less predictable.
